分类 wordpress 下的文章

尽量使用2栏式的模板。虽然现在我们可以很轻松的找到好多漂亮的模板,2栏的,3栏的,甚至4栏的都有。
但是,对于SEO的优化,我们最好选择的是2栏的模板。
因为对网站内容的抓取一般是从左到右,从上到下的。
如果你的左侧刚好有几个侧栏,那么搜索网站会先抓取你的链接,RSS等的东西……

站内链接优化

一个网站的链接体系架构是非常重要的,对于用户来说,良好的链接体系架构能够让用户立刻明白这个网站主要介绍什么内容,并且快速找到他所需要的内容,而对于搜索引擎来说,良好的链接体系架构能让站点的页面正确被搜索引擎索引,保证 Google 爬虫正确找到页面。

保持重要的页面在首页有链接,网站的首页是最重要的页面,也是搜索引擎最经常来访问的页面,所以该页面我们应该尽量把更多的重要页面链接显示到首页。但是也要注意,千万不要超过100个链接。
站内的页面都要有链接至首页
建立面包屑链接,网站建立明晰的导航和层次结构。
相关联的网页内容要做互链,如文章下方的“相关文章”功能。建议安装相关日志插件。
相关关键字链接至相关文章,比如你以前日志中有过关于“key1”的文章,在以后的文章中都可以将“key1”链接至之前的那个页面,以产生关联性。
记得定期清除无效链接。

获取反向链接

从外部链接到你的网站的链接,称为“反向链接”,反向链接是搜索引擎衡量网站质量的重要依据,是SEO工作的重点,如何增加反向链接?

提供高质量的原创内容,自然能得到大量的反向链接。高质量的原创内容,容易被无数个网站进行转载,有版权意识的网站会在他的网站上留下你的链接地址。
将网站加入到相关的目录中去,比如DMOZ开放目录、高质量的网址导航站、和你网站主题相关的网站互链。
做一些总结性的专题、列表、索引,人们很喜欢收藏此类,从而赢得反向链接。比如:iPad 装机必备十大免费软件。
在与网站主题相关的大型网站上发表文章,比如客座博客。
提供免费的服务和产品,比如提供免费的 WordPress 主题给人下载,用的人越多,你获取的链接越多。

除了站内优化,站外优化也一样重要,两样都做好了才能较快的获得较好排名。
站外的优化最主要的是做外链这一块,网站的权重主要是靠高质量的外链来提升,就算你网站不更新,有大量的外链做支撑,网站还是照样天天快照,权重和PR值都不会低。

做外链主要有以下几种途径:

一是写软文推广。因为写软文投稿成功后,不仅能获得一些转载,还能认识到你的网站。

二是百度知道推广。我添加了几个和自己行业相关的关键词为关注,一有相关的问题就会显示在我的知道首页上,我每天都抽空给网友们耐心回答,偶尔插入网站的链接,因为账号级别不低,插入链接的成功率也不低,坚持这个习惯,久而久之外链也会稳步提升,做外链就是一个细水长流的工作。还有一个好处就是不少站点采集百度知道上的内容,会把网站链接都采集过去,无形中也给网站带来一点点帮助。百度知道推广如果插入链接成功了,不仅仅能带来导出链接,还让网友认识到你的网站,来到你的网站,或许就成了你的忠实访客。还有个好处就是,大家都知道百度自身的产品比其他网站较容易获得排名,该问题获得了较好的排名是,网友点击进去后,你的链接又存在,又会顺着你的链接来到你的网站。

三是论坛推广。论坛推广我主要在论坛上给网友们解答问题,偶尔也会插入链接,就算不插入链接,签名里面也留下了我的链接,也是与自己行业相关的,所以点击率也挺高的。做论坛推广我一般都会点击最新帖子,然后挑里面的内容进行回复,因为最新帖子一般跟帖都很少,引用逛猫扑看到较多的一句话“万一火了呢?”,好处大家都知道。还有就是在一些站长论坛上转发我写的软文,或者回下帖子,签名里都有带网站的链接。

四是社会化书签推广。博客里面放了段分享到各个社会化书签的代码,方便访客分享网站也方便自己。每当有新内容发布时,我都会顺手分享到好几个社会化书签上的。给网站增加些外链。

五是RSS和邮件订阅推广。不少来织梦管理员之家的网友都会对网站进行订阅,如RSS订阅或邮件订阅,进行邮件订阅的朋友挺多的,因为博客有新内容更新后,第二天会发邮件到订阅的邮箱上面,方便访客回访,也给网站带来不少流量。

做好网站优化的同时优质的内容也是必不可少的,网站优化做好了,搜索引擎给你带来流量,能让访客记住你网站再次回访的,还得网站能有给他带来帮助的地方。

打开single.php在文章底部添加以下代码

<div>
<p>文章作者:<a href=”<?php echo get_option(‘home’); ?>/”><?php the_author(); ?></a><br/>
本文地址:<a href=”<?php the_permalink() ?>”><?php the_permalink() ?></a><br />
版权所有 &copy; 转载时必须以链接形式注明作者和原始出处!</p>
</div>

在style.css找到.under{}进行修改CSS属性

看到很多网站都带有ico图标或favicon图标,这个的话方便用户记住你网站,同时便于用户在收藏夹上快速找到你网站。
今天我们谈谈如何给WordPress添加网站图标,方法很简单的,只需2步就可以实现。

1.制作网站图标首先我们用photoshop做好网站的图标图片,大小最好是1616,或者3232的,不要过大了,之后转换成为ico图标格式即可,然后把这个ico格式的图片改名为favicon.ico当ico图标做好了,直接用FTP软件上传到WordPress根目录。
2.编辑代码我们进入WordPress后台,找到“外观”模版下的“编辑”功能,并且编辑“顶部”(header.php)代码。在……放入以下代码即可。<link id="favicon" href="<?php bloginfo('url'); ?>/favicon.ico" rel="icon" type="image/x-icon" />中间的网址替换成你的网站地址。
3.更新代码。然后刷新网站,即可看到网站的图标了。

问题描述
部署WEB项目后,开启了强制HTTPS,产生如下错误:
Mixed Content: The page at 'XXX' was loaded over HTTPS, but requested an insecure stylesheet 'XXXXXXX'. This request has been blocked; the content must be served over HTTPS.

问题分析
报错的原因就是当前页面是https协议加载的,但是这个页面发起了一个http的ajax请求,这种做法是非法的。HTTPS页面里动态的引入HTTP资源,比如引入一个js文件,会被直接block掉的.在HTTPS页面里通过AJAX的方式请求HTTP资源,也会被直接block掉的。

解决办法
可以在相应的页面的里加上这句代码,意思是自动将http的不安全请求升级为https

<meta http-equiv="Content-Security-Policy" content="upgrade-insecure-requests">

找到wordpress安装目录/wp-content/themes/你的主题名
然后一般找到header.php或者head.php进行编辑
在标记下插入

<meta http-equiv="Content-Security-Policy" content="upgrade-insecure-requests" />

编辑后保存文件

什么是Mixed Content?
Mixed Content(混合内容)出现于如下场景:HTML页面是通过HTTPS加载的,但是其他资源文件(如图片,视频,样式表文件,脚本)是使用HTTP方式加载的。之所以称为混合内容,是因为在一个网页中同时使用了HTTP和HTTPS,而最初的请求方式为 HTTPS。
现代浏览器可能会阻止此类内容,或者显示关于此类内容的警告,提醒用户此页面包含不安全的内容。阻止混合内容的浏览器可能会首先尝试将该内容的连接从HTTP “升级”到HTTPS。

WordPress Mixed Content混合内容警告不会阻止您的网站在页面上显示内容。但是,您需要在看到警告后立即解决它,因为它会对您网站的 SEO 排名产生负面影响。

使用 Elementor 页面构建器
Elementor 插件使您能够使用其拖放功能构建 WordPress 网站。但是,它还具有一项功能,可让您查找和替换网站上的不安全链接。
如果您已经安装了 Elementor,则最好使用此选项。如果没有,请使用Better Search Replace插件。
在您的仪表板中,转到Elementor > 工具,然后单击替换 URL选项卡。
现在,在旧 URL 文本框中使用 HTTP 格式输入您的网站。然后在新的 URL 文本框中输入您网站的安全 HTTPS 版本。
然后,点击Replace URL
如果使用上述任何插件修复了 WordPress 网站上的混合内容警告,那就太好了。但是,如果您仍然看到它们,则可能是硬编码的脚本/图像是原因。为此,您需要手动替换主题文件上的链接。

手动替换 HTTP 文件

有时,当您从外部链接加载脚本时,使用上述插件中的查找和替换功能不会替换脚本 URL。在这种情况下,您可以手动替换主题文件中的不安全链接。
首先,转到外观>主题编辑器并选择标题模板。
现在,键入 CTRL+F 打开搜索框并将导致混合内容警告的链接粘贴到您的网站上。
找到代码行后,将其替换为安全版本的链接(即将 http:// 更改为 https://)。
此外,如果您使用绝对路径链接到网站上的图像或样式表,您可以修改链接以使用相对路径。
例如,如果您的图像具有以下路径“ http://yoursite.com/images/logo.png ”,则可以将其替换为“ /images/logo.png ”
完成后,单击更新文件。